After being told his granddaughter Lily had only days before the virus would end her life, Dr Hector Stein took matters into his own hands to find a cure. This came at a risk though, as he knew that his actions could kill him so driven by love fuelled madness, the crazy scientist found you to experiment on. Can you find the antidote in one hour to help you escape?

A journey with multiple rooms that was not expecting. You start in a dark room and make your way into well designed & themed rooms. The puzzles are logical and one particularly fun element requiring skill with hand eye coordination. Great hosts who were happy to chat about escape rooms as a whole

Previously known as The Room Maidstone, The Extraction Room recently rebranded to avoid a naming conflict with a different escape room company. Their now-eponymous first game follows well-trodden ground by having you imprisoned by an insane scientist, though throws in a touch of moral ambiguity by adding that your captor's motivation is to find a cure for a virus and thereby save his daughter. We were impressed with Extraction. It was a fun, and interesting room. If this first game from the Extraction Room team is anything to go by, if they decide to expand and design more games, I can only wait with anticipation to see what they come up with.

Its safe to say that the team at The Extraction Room have produced a room to be proud of, which pulls together great use of space, solid well thought out on theme puzzles and a sense of tension that many others would dream of. This is an hour of fun I would encourage you to book now! 
The Extraction Room was an immersive, story driven, original escape experience which made perfect use of space and types of puzzles. The highly detailed sets through the different scenes gave the experience this eerie feel and made the experience perfect. 

Good looking room with 3 very different areas, a good mix of puzzles, very friendly game master, a thoroughly enjoyable experience.
